Hello,
After a system/world update my user account dealmeida cannot be logged to or
root cannot su to it. When su - dealmeida is issued at the root command
prompt, it immediately returns to root. When login is at the console the
motd appears (twice; why?) and then the session is closed. In the
/var/log/messages I get
May 2 20:42:35 xeon0 su[29286]: Successful su for dealmeida by root
May 2 20:42:35 xeon0 su[29286]: + pts/1 root:dealmeida
May 2 20:42:35 xeon0 su[29286]: pam_unix(su:session): session opened for
user dealmeida by root(uid=0)
May 2 20:42:35 xeon0 su[29286]: pam_unix(su:session): session closed for
user dealmeida
No other account has this problem.
Any ideas?
Thanks,
Is the user's shell set properly?
I made no changes in the account and looked over the . startup files;
they look okay. Also, the output of password -S dealmeida are fine.
Still puzzled why motd appears twice even at root login.
